Gloster has an obesity rate of 50.3%, which is 14.2pp above the national average. The depression rate is 17.9%, 5.6pp below the national average. About 14.4% of adults lack health insurance. 84.7% of residents had an annual checkup in the past year. There are 5 hospitals nearby. 4 offer emergency services. The average CMS quality rating is 2.0 out of 5.
